How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Hennepin?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Hennepin Studio Apartments | $717 | $625 | $850 |
| Hennepin 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,002 | $675 | $1,800 |
| Hennepin 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,340 | $805 | $2,675 |
| Hennepin 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,393 | $795 | $1,962 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Hennepin
How much are Studio apartments in Hennepin?
There are currently 6 Studio Apartments in Hennepin with rent ranges from $625 to $850 with an average price of $717.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Hennepin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Hennepin ranges from $675 to $1,800 with an average monthly rent of $1,002.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Hennepin c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Hennepin range from $805 to $2,675.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,340.
How expensive are Hennepin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 7 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Hennepin on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$795 to $1,962 - averaging $1,393 for the location.
